The well-known actress has decided to return to one of the most sensational events in her life, which apparently had a significant impact on her career as an artist. In an interview for "Esquire" magazine, the actress revealed the fact that she has been "controlled" all the time by Hollywood, especially after the theft scandal and all the attention that the media paid to this event.

"Yes, I was kept under surveillance and under surveillance for a long time," Ryder told the magazine when asked how she dealt with the aftermath of her arrest.

In 2000, the "Beetlejuice" star was arrested and charged with stealing $5,500 worth of clothing from Saks Fifth Avenue in Beverly Hills. A year later, she was convicted of shoplifting and sentenced to three years probation for that charge.  

Ryder admitted that trouble with the law, especially after her sentence, had a "huge effect" on her acting career, something that came as a surprise to her in those years.

"I was very confused at the time. There were only a few papers I had to sign, and I even remember being told I had to go to jail for theft and I was just shocked,” she adds.

Immediately after the trial, Ryder broke away from acting for many years, even moving to live in Los Angeles in San Francisco. When she returned to the public eye, the actress says she was really "very scared", especially because of the way the media had badly "hit" her figure as a woman, but also as an actress.

"I felt like there was a big change in the culture and the film industry, especially after my comeback," she continues. "It was 10 or 15 years of separation, when everything changed. It was a very difficult period for me, which has left quite a few consequences in my personal life, but also as a public figure," concludes the actress.
